I rewarded myself with an afternoon of sewing.  I had the dog quilt that has been sitting around here waiting for a back and quilting.  So now it is done.  I just did it on my domestic Husky.  Simple straight lines in a chevron.  I pieced the back using some fabric from my stash.   A nice large dog print and some yucky green that sort of went with the dog colors.  Are you not impressed that I have a space in the middle of my quilt room CLEANED OUT enough to almost accommodate a lap quilt?  Yes, impressed you should be.

The front of the quilt is one of those 1600 Strip Race Quilts made from about 38 dog prints I have collected over the years.  I still have dog prints.  But this one looks pretty intense, so I won't do this pattern with the rest of them.
